Community Projects

Make A Difference Day- The MCI class participates every year in Make A Difference Day, a national day of doing good. The following were some of past projects-

2004- Book Collection for Little Sprouts Day Care- the MCI class won an honorable mention from the Points Of Light Foundation for this project.

2005- Biscuits for Katrina Dogs- The MCI class and Mrs. Heinke's Multiply Disabled class baked dog biscuits for dogs who were displaced by Hurricane Katrina. The dogs were being sheltered at the Sussex County Fairgrounds.

2006- Book Collection for Little Sprouts Day Care Part 2- This time we collected over 600 children's books for the children and families of Project Self-Sufficiency and Little Sprouts Day Care. The MCI students also delivered the books and read stories to the children.

2007- We are currently working on a project to coordinate a district-wide collection of letters to soldiers, artwork for soldiers and funds to purchase pre-paid phone cards for military personnel.
